Oh absolutely. I think I noted that in my message of a couple of days
ago. It's just my opinion that a volunteer shouldn't have to pick up
anything that anybody else left behind. And I didn't notice any messes
anyplace other then Robinson Flat. Well, except for a lady leading her
horse down the concrete walkway from the barn office into the fairground
arena. Just in front of the public restrooms. Maybe the horse figured
that was the proper place. :) She let her horse stop to poop and just
walked away after she was finished. It was only a couple of hundred feet
from the food tent.  Flies food, yummy. An hour later is was still there
so I kicked it off to the side. Maybe a benign substance for the most
part, but bad form to leave it in the middle of a public walkway. Again
just my opinion.
